For instance, according to Kovecses (1991), there are many conceptual metaphors for happiness in English but three of them have been recognized as major metaphors: HAPPINESS IS UP 'I'm feeling up', 'I'm walking on air', HAPPINESS IS LIGHT 'She brightened up', HAPPINESS IS A FLUID IN A CONTAINER 'He's bursting with joy'

Happiness is an emotional state characterized by feelings of joy, satisfaction, contentment, and fulfillment. Because happiness tends to be such a broadly defined term, psychologists and other social scientists typically use the term 'subjective well-being' when they talk about this emotional state.
